HRS §431:10C-117.5

Insurer can recover deductible from at-fault insured

If an insurance company pays for injuries or death caused by its policyholder, and the policyholder's actions made the deductible not apply, the insurer can get that deductible amount back from the policyholder.

The statute, as written — Additional civil liability

An insurer whose insured causes death or injury to another person, and that is not entitled to the reduction provided in section 431:10C-301.5, shall be entitled to recover the amount of the covered loss deductible that would have applied from the insured whose conduct resulted in inapplicability of the covered loss deductible.
